The Arizona Lottery is a state agency of Arizona in the southwest United States. It is a member of the Multi-State Lottery Association (MUSL). Lottery draw games include Mega Millions, Powerball, The Pick, Triple Twist Fantasy 5, and Pick 3.A variety of instant scratch tickets, or Scratchers, are also offered. The Arizona Lottery's mission statement is to support Arizona programs for the ...

$1 - $599 Prizes. All Arizona Lottery retailers will redeem prizes up to $100, and may redeem prizes up to $599. Find a Location. $600+ Prizes. Redeem your prize by completing a Winner’s Claim Form, then mailing it or bringing it to the Phoenix or Tucson Arizona Lottery office.

Tucson: 520.325.9141. All Other Areas: 800.499.3798. Scratchers games are easy to play and instructions are printed right on the ticket! A Scratchers game is played by scratching a layer away from the ticket to reveal a series of numbers or symbols and their corresponding prizes.
